Subject: Relevance cut-over complete — Trovelight search

Team, the cut-over to the new ranking profile finished Tuesday night with no rollback needed. Click-through on long-tail queries is up modestly; exact-match boosts were lowered per Dariela's tuning notes, and synonym expansion is now enabled by default. One caveat: recency weighting is still on the old curve until next sprint. For reference at the sync, the live ranking configuration is as follows.

deployment values, bajop-yahaf:
[holax]
host = holax.tolvaqsys.corp
user = holax_svc
database = holax_prod

Subject: Key rotation — Fenwick ingest

Rotating the Fenwick ingest key today as part of the SDK parity audit. The Kotlin and Swift clients now expose identical retry and telemetry options, so both will consume the same credential path. Old key dies at 18:00. For your review record, the replacement key is as follows.

app token of bahaf-tajeg = zpat23_SjjsllwiLmXbtS65veZaV47

TURN-208: Gatevale turnstile counters at the Merrow Field pilot double-count when a rotation reverses mid-cycle. Attendance totals drift roughly 2% high per event. The debounce window fix is implemented, reviewed by Ilsa, and soak-tested across two simulated match days without drift. Ready for your cut; the candidate build is identified below.

trace token, tagag-tafog: htk6_5ed18c

Handover Note — Logistics Provider Transition

To whoever picks this up from me: we are mid-switch from Bramfield Freight to Oxlade Carriers. Contracts are signed; the overlap period runs eight weeks, during which both invoices will hit the finance queue. Please reconcile against the transition schedule, not the old rate card. Oxlade's fuel surcharge is variable, so flag anomalies early.

The strategic rationale is captured in the note below.

board note of bagug-kafof: The steering committee signed off on a budget of $55.0 million for Project Fraox. The renewal with Fenvanek Freight closes at $37.0 million a year, 4 percent above the last contract.